Intel 81342 Developer's Manual page 563

Table of Contents

Advertisement

D D R S D R A M M e m o r y C o n t r o l l e r — I n t e l
7 . 0
D D R S D R A M M e m o r y C o n t r o l l e r
T h i s c h a p t e r d e s c r i b e s t h e i n t e g r a t e d M e m o r y C o n t r o l l e r U n i t ( D M C U ) , w i t h o p e r a t i n g
m o d e s , i n i t i a l i z a t i o n , e x t e r n a l i n t e r f a c e s , a n d i m p l e m e n t a t i o n d e t a i l s .
7 . 1
O v e r v i e w
T h e I n t e l ® 8 1 3 4 1 a n d 8 1 3 4 2 I / O P r o c e s s o r s ( 8 1 3 4 1 a n d 8 1 3 4 2 ) i n t e g r a t e s a
h i g h - p e r f o r m a n c e , m u l t i - p o r t e d M e m o r y C o n t r o l l e r t o p r o v i d e a d i r e c t i n t e r f a c e
b e t w e e n t h e 8 1 3 4 1 a n d 8 1 3 4 2 a n d i t s l o c a l m e m o r y s u b s y s t e m . T h e M e m o r y C o n t r o l l e r
s u p p o r t s :
• P C 3 2 0 0 / P C 4 3 0 0 D o u b l e D a t a R a t e I I ( D D R 2 4 0 0 M H z a n d D D R 2 5 3 3 M H z ) S D R A M
• 5 1 2 M b i t a n d 1 G b i t a n d 2 G b i t D D R - I I S D R A M t e c h n o l o g y s u p p o r t
• R e g i s t e r e d a n d U n b u f f e r e d D D R 2 D I M M s u p p o r t
• D e d i c a t e d p o r t f o r I n t e l X S c a l e ® m i c r o a r c h i t e c t u r e s t o D D R 2 S D R A M
• B e t w e e n 2 5 6 M B y t e s a n d 4 G B y t e s o f 6 4 - b i t D D R 2 S D R A M
• 3 6 - b i t a d d r e s s a b l e
• T w o m e m o r y w i n d o w s t o a d d r e s s t h e s a m e D D R S D R A M M e m o r y
• O p t i m i z e d c o r e p r o c e s s o r d a t a p r o c e s s i n g 3 2 - b i t r e g i o n
• S i n g l e - b i t e r r o r c o r r e c t i o n , m u l t i - b i t d e t e c t i o n s u p p o r t ( E C C )
• 3 2 - , 4 0 - a n d 6 4 - , 7 2 - b i t w i d e M e m o r y I n t e r f a c e s ( n o n - E C C a n d E C C s u p p o r t )
D D R 2 S D R A M i n t e r f a c e p r o v i d e s a d i r e c t c o n n e c t i o n t o a h i g h b a n d w i d t h a n d r e l i a b l e
m e m o r y s u b s y s t e m . T h e D D R 2 S D R A M i n t e r f a c e c o n s i s t s o f a 6 4 - b i t w i d e d a t a p a t h t o
s u p p o r t u p t o 4 . 3 G B y t e s / s t h r o u g h p u t . A n 8 - b i t E r r o r C o r r e c t i o n C o d e ( E C C ) a c r o s s
e a c h 6 4 - b i t w o r d i m p r o v e s s y s t e m r e l i a b i l i t y . T h e E C C i s s t o r e d i n t h e D D R S D R A M
a r r a y a l o n g w i t h d a t a a n d c h e c k e d w h e n d a t a i s r e a d . W h e n c o d e i s i n c o r r e c t , t h e
D M C U c o r r e c t s d a t a ( w h e n p o s s i b l e ) b e f o r e r e a c h i n g t h e r e a d i n i t i a t o r . U s e r - d e f i n e d
f a u l t c o r r e c t i o n s o f t w a r e i s r e s p o n s i b l e f o r s c r u b b i n g t h e m e m o r y a r r a y . D M C U s u p p o r t s
t w o b a n k s o f D D R S D R A M m a d e u p o f a t w o - b a n k d u a l - i n l i n e m e m o r y m o d u l e ( D I M M ) :
• D M C U h a s s u p p o r t f o r R e g i s t e r e d a n d U n b u f f e r e d P C 3 2 0 0 a n d P C 4 3 0 0 D I M M s .
• T h e D M C U s u p p o r t s a 3 2 - b i t S D R A M d a t a i n t e r f a c e . T h i s m o d e e n a b l e s l o w e r - c o s t
s o l u t i o n s a t t h e c o s t o f s y s t e m p e r f o r m a n c e .
• T h e D M C U r e s p o n d s t o i n t e r n a l b u s a n d c o r e p r o c e s s o r m e m o r y a c c e s s e s w i t h i n i t s
p r o g r a m m e d a d d r e s s r a n g e a n d i s s u e s t h e m e m o r y r e q u e s t t o t h e D D R S D R A M
i n t e r f a c e .
• T h e D M C U c o n t a i n s t r a n s a c t i o n q u e u e s f o r e a c h p o r t e n a b l i n g p i p e l i n i n g o f
t r a n s a c t i o n s t o t h e D D R S D R A M f o r m a x i m u m p e r f o r m a n c e .
• F o r 6 4 - b i t E C C m e m o r y , a 3 2 - b i t m e m o r y r e g i o n p r o g r a m m a b l e t o o p e r a t e a s
3 2 - b i t E C C m e m o r y f o r h i g h e r c o r e w r i t e p e r f o r m a n c e b y a v o i d i n g
R e a d - M o d i f y - W r i t e ( R M W ) o p e r a t i o n o f D D R S D R A M .
• T h e D M C U p r o v i d e s t w o c h i p e n a b l e s t o t h e m e m o r y s u b s y s t e m . T h e s e t w o c h i p
e n a b l e s s e r v i c e t h e D D R S D R A M s u b s y s t e m ( o n e p e r b a n k ) .
D e c e m b e r 2 0 0 7
O r d e r N u m b e r : 3 1 5 0 3 7 - 0 0 2 U S
®
8 1 3 4 1 a n d 8 1 3 4 2
®
I n t e l
8 1 3 4 1 a n d 8 1 3 4 2 I / O P r o c e s s o r s
D e v e l o p e r ' s M a n u a l
5 6 3

Advertisement

Table of Contents
loading

This manual is also suitable for:

81341

Table of Contents